Commonly known as MS, multiple sclerosis is an immune-mediated disease in which the body’s immune system mistakenly attacks myelin (the fatty substance that surrounds and insulates nerve fibers) in the central nervous system. Damage to the myelin and nerves fibers disrupts or destroys the signals sent throughout the central nervous system and may produce neurological symptoms that vary in type and severity. Verna explains that her relapsing-remitting MS (the most common type) is characterized by attacks or relapses of new or increasing neurologic symptoms. These relapses are followed by periods of partial or complete recovery called remissions. In remissions, symptoms may completely disappear, and some may continue or become permanent; however, there is no apparent progression of the disease during the periods of remission. A common symptom for patients with MS is disruption of the signals that regulate urination. For those affected, urination can become frequent and urgent, or they may struggle to urinate at all. Bowel elimination and retention may also be impacted. One amazing treatment for these issues is the Axonics sacral neuromodulation sytem. A small, battery powered neurostimulator implant is surgically placed during a non-invasive outpatient procedure. This device can be remotely controlled by the patient and provides gentle stimulation to the nerves that control the bladder and bowels. After a urodynamics assessment to determine the extent of her bladder dysfunction, Dr. Jacomides placed a temporary Axonics device so Verna could "test drive" it before getting the semi-permanent implant. Right away, she noticed a huge difference and decided this was the right fit for her. Once an Axonics rep helped Verna find the right settings for her unique symptoms, she no longer had to urinate every 15 minutes or limit her travel based on bathroom availability. She now serves as an ambassador for Axonics in addition to her advocacy for patients with MS. You can see and hear her story in the MS documentary Beneath The Surface.
